One problem with walking is that you can't check in until 4:30 am. If you're hunting anywhere on the Western portion of the Island, it may take you an hour or longer to hike in. By the time you get settled in, you're looking at a late arrival, possibly well after first light depending on the time of year and what kind of terrain you have to work your way through. I don't imagine anyone wants to be late an risk spooking deer on a hunt like this.
Like I said, I don't have a ATV so I will be using a mtn. bike. I like to be settled in my stand 1.5 hours before first light. On my hunt, sunrise will be at 7:05, so first light will probably be between 6 and 6:15. Hopefully, I can get on it and be in my stand by 5:00. On foot, this just wouldn't be possible unless you stayed close to the parking area.
I don't mind walking a long ways, but in this case, I would want to be walking by 4:00 am and that won't be possible. A bike could cut the approach time in half. A ATV could cut it down to a 3rd of the time.

I was there last year. You are allowed to ride on the roads and you can cross the fields to get to the woods edge. Riding in the woods is not permitted. You will not disturb anyone if you follow the rules. You are more likely to mess someone up by walking around during prime hunting hours. If you hunt in the open fields then you will have to deal with people messing you up.
